Azerbaijan Violates Ceasefire Regime, hindering Exchange of Bodies and Captives
Azerbaijan, by violating the ceasefire regime, has launched attacks in the southern and northern directions but has been repelled with losses. This was stated by the spokesperson for the Ministry of Defense, Artsrun Hovhannisyan, during a press conference.
“Today, in certain areas, a relatively calm situation has been maintained, and there has been no fire from large-caliber weapons; however, the ceasefire regime, which would allow the exchange of bodies and captives, has not been fully adhered to. There have been false statements alleging that the Armenian side is violating the ceasefire regime. Azerbaijan is attempting to create a basis for provocation in this manner,” he said.
